Specialized traps utilizing acidic lures act as a critical defensive barrier against phorid fly infestations in stingless bee colonies. By employing specific attractants—most notably vinegar or sugar-vinegar solutions—these devices intercept adult flies like Pseudohypocera kerteszi before they can infiltrate the hive, preventing the deposition of eggs that leads to larval infestation and colony collapse.
By capturing adult flies outside the hive, specialized traps break the reproductive cycle of the pest without introducing harmful chemicals. This preserves the delicate internal ecosystem of the colony while ensuring the long-term viability of honey production.
The Mechanism of Protection
Exploiting Chemical Attraction
Phorid flies are naturally drawn to specific acidic scents that signal potential breeding grounds. Specialized traps leverage this biological drive by using vinegar or sugar-vinegar solutions as bait. This effectively lures the pests away from the hive entrance and into a containment vessel.
Breaking the Reproductive Cycle
The primary threat to the colony is not the adult fly, but its larvae. If an adult fly enters the hive, it lays eggs that hatch into larvae which consume the bee brood and food stores. By capturing the adult female flies externally, the traps prevent the eggs from ever entering the system.
Eliminating Chemical Risks
Stingless bees are highly sensitive to environmental toxins. Traps function as a physical biological control method, eliminating the need for synthetic pesticides. This ensures the honey produced remains pure and the bees are not exposed to chemical agents that could compromise their health.
Strategic Implementation in Apiaries
Monitoring and Early Warning
Beyond simple removal, these traps serve as essential monitoring devices. The number of flies captured provides beekeepers with real-time data regarding the density of the local pest population. This allows for proactive adjustments to apiary management before an infestation becomes unmanageable.
Complementing Physical Defenses
Traps are most effective when used in conjunction with high-precision hive construction. While traps reduce the pest population, well-sealed hives with specialized entrance structures minimize the entry points for any flies that evade the lures. This layered approach creates a robust defense system for the colony.
Understanding the Trade-offs
Maintenance Requirements
These traps are not "set and forget" solutions; they utilize consumables that degrade over time. The acidic solutions must be replenished regularly to maintain their attractive potency. Failure to maintain the lures renders the traps ineffective, leaving the colony vulnerable.
Limitation of Scope
Traps are preventative and reductive, but they cannot cure a colony that is already heavily infested internally. If the physical integrity of the hive is compromised (poor sealing or gaps), traps alone may not stop all intruders. They must be viewed as part of a holistic management strategy, not a standalone cure.
